Hotels in Munnar often feature a variety of garden types that enhance the serene environment of the region. Many resorts provide beautifully landscaped gardens with native flora, carefully curated to blend with the natural landscape. These gardens can include spice gardens showcasing local herbs like cardamom and pepper, as well as flower gardens filled with colorful blooms catering to both aesthetics and local fauna. Furthermore, some hotels have small organic gardens from which they source fresh ingredients for their on-site restaurants, showcasing a commitment to sustainability and quality.

Many hotels with gardens in Munnar prioritize sustainability, reflecting the region's emphasis on preserving its natural beauty. These establishments often implement eco-friendly practices, such as using organic gardening techniques, composting kitchen waste, and conserving water through efficient irrigation systems. Some even engage in reforestation efforts or partner with local communities to promote environmental awareness. Staying at such hotels not only provides a delightful experience but also supports initiatives that help sustain the beauty of Munnar for generations to come.
